MRI is one of the fastest-growing careers, tracing its origins back to 1977 when Dr. Raymond Damadian revolutionized medical imaging with the invention of the first MRI scanner. This groundbreaking technology transformed healthcare by providing detailed, non-invasive imaging, essential for diagnosing a wide range of conditions. Today, the demand for skilled MRI technologists is at an all-time high, driven by advancements in imaging techniques and the increasing reliance on MRI for accurate, life-saving diagnoses. As the healthcare industry continues to expand, so does the need for well-trained professionals who can operate this sophisticated technology with precision and care.

Why Online MRI Programs Are Essential for Developing Competent MRI Technologists

In today’s fast-paced world, online MRI programs have emerged as an essential tool for aspiring technologists looking to master this intricate and vital field. These programs provide a flexible and comprehensive approach to education, combining theoretical knowledge with practical simulation training. By learning through interactive modules, students can grasp the complexities of MRI physics, anatomy, and safety protocols at their own pace. This accessibility not only broadens the opportunity for more individuals to enter the profession but also ensures that students receive a well-rounded education that prepares them for real-world scenarios. Online MRI programs are particularly valuable for their ability to incorporate cutting-edge technologies, like virtual MRI simulators, that allow students to practice and refine their skills in a risk-free environment before stepping into clinical settings.

Moreover, the structured yet adaptable nature of online MRI programs fosters a strong foundation for lifelong learning—a crucial trait for any healthcare professional. The field of medical imaging is constantly evolving, with new techniques and advancements emerging regularly. Online platforms equip students with the resources to stay updated, ensuring they remain competent and confident in their practice. By offering 24/7 access to course materials, expert guidance, and peer collaboration, these programs enable future MRI technologists to develop the expertise, ethics, and adaptability necessary to excel in their careers. For anyone aspiring to join this high-demand field, an online MRI program is not just a convenient option; it is a critical step toward becoming a skilled and sought-after professional.

According to a new report by US News “MRI Technologists made a median salary of $73,410 in 2019. The best-paid 25 percent made $87,280 that year, while the lowest-paid 25 percent made $61,030.” As a matter of fact, our graduates in Iowa make on average $1218 weekly.
